In this article. Getting Started with DirectX graphics. Microsoft DirectX graphics provides a set of APIs that you can use to create games and other high-performance multimedia apps. DirectX graphics includes support for high-performance 2-D and 3-D graphics. Direct2D is a hardware-accelerated, immediate-mode, 2-D graphics API that provides high performance and high-quality rendering for 2-D geometry, bitmaps, and text. DirectWrite supports high-quality text rendering, resolution-independent outline fonts, and full Unicode text and layouts.

The windowsnumerics. Variable Rate Shading allows developers to control shading rate dynamically, shading as little as once per sixteen pixels or as often as eight times per pixel. Sampler Feedback allows developers to precisely determine where and when texture data needs to be loaded, enabling rapid GPU-based asset streaming.

The first time you click a Help shortcut, you will be asked to confirm that you wish to connect to the Internet to view documentation in the MSDN cloud. If you wish to view documentation when a connection to the Internet is unavailable, you can import documentation sets books from the MSDN cloud and install these books to your computer.

You can then switch to Offline Mode to view content on your computer by default. To import content to your local computer for viewing in offline mode, select "Install Content from online" in Help Library Manager. To remove imported content from your local computer, select "Remove content" in Help Library Manager. If you import content to your local computer, use Help Library Manager to specify, "I want to use local help" to switch to Offline Mode. DirectX 11 Runtime symbols are included in the Windows 7 and Windows Server R2 symbols packages available on the Microsoft website.

However, we recommend using the Microsoft symbols server instead for the most current and correct set of symbols when debugging DirectX applications. They can be obtained from the Microsoft symbol server.
